How does blockchain contribute to the transparency and accountability of cryptocurrencies?

- Blockchain technology plays a crucial role in ensuring the transparency and accountability of cryptocurrencies. By its nature, blockchain is a decentralized and distributed ledger that records all transactions in a transparent and immutable manner. This means that every transaction made with a cryptocurrency is recorded on the blockchain and can be verified by anyone. This transparency eliminates the need for intermediaries and allows for a high level of trust in the system. Additionally, the decentralized nature of blockchain makes it extremely difficult for any single entity to manipulate or alter the transaction history, further enhancing the accountability of cryptocurrencies.

- Blockchain is like a public ledger that keeps track of all cryptocurrency transactions. It ensures transparency by making all transactions visible to everyone on the network. This means that anyone can check the transaction history and verify the authenticity of each transaction. Moreover, blockchain's decentralized nature prevents any single entity from controlling or manipulating the data, making it highly secure and accountable. So, in short, blockchain technology contributes to the transparency and accountability of cryptocurrencies by providing a tamper-proof and publicly accessible record of all transactions.
